Stand up to Racism in Leeds has called for a ‘Refugees Welcome, No to the Far Right, No to Reform’ protest in Leeds city center on Saturday 11th October.  We envisage that this will be a celebration of our diversity, bringing together trade unions, community and faith based groups and other organizations in a show of unity and solidarity.

As I’m sure you are aware, over 100,000 people responded to Nazi Tommy Robinson’s call to march through central London on September 13th.  This represents the biggest far right mobilization in British history.  It will give racists and fascists the confidence to go further in boldly spreading their racists lies and hateful speech.  They want to divide the working class by mobilizing anger and misdirecting it against migrants and refugees.  But further than that, they oppose every progressive cause that trade unions stand for, racial, gender and sexual equality and the defense of the rights of oppressed minority groups.
